Manual Data Entry And Inaccurate Asset Records: Challenges In Asset Valuation And Planning

Accurate asset records are critical for organizations to determine their financial standing, plan for future investments, and ensure operational efficiency. However, many companies still rely on manual data entry for asset management, which often results in inaccuracies, inconsistencies, and inefficiencies. These inaccuracies, in turn, lead to incorrect asset valuation and flawed planning decisions.

The Problem with Manual Data Entry

Manual data entry involves human operators recording asset information into spreadsheets or outdated databases. This process is prone to errors due to fatigue, misinterpretation of data, and inconsistent formatting. Even minor inaccuracies, such as typographical errors, missing serial numbers, or incorrect purchase dates, can cause significant discrepancies in asset records.

For instance, if a company mistakenly records an asset’s acquisition date as two years earlier than its actual purchase date, the depreciation calculations will be incorrect. This not only distorts the book value of the asset but also impacts financial reporting and tax calculations.

Accurate asset valuation is essential for financial statements, insurance claims, and strategic decision-making. Inaccurate records caused by manual data entry can result in:

Overvaluation or Undervaluation of Assets: When asset data contains errors, the reported value of the asset may be significantly higher or lower than its actual worth. This misrepresentation can affect the company's financial health on paper, misleading stakeholders and investors.

Incorrect Depreciation Calculation: Asset depreciation schedules rely on precise acquisition dates and costs. Inaccurate data entry can lead to over-depreciation or under-depreciation, impacting tax deductions and financial forecasting.

Inaccurate Financial Reporting: Companies that maintain erroneous asset records may produce inaccurate financial reports, which could affect audits and compliance with accounting standards.

Consequences for Planning and Decision-Making

Poor asset records hinder effective planning and decision-making. Organizations depend on accurate data to make informed choices regarding asset maintenance, replacement, and investment. When asset data is unreliable:

Maintenance Scheduling Becomes Inefficient: Inaccurate records can lead to missed maintenance cycles or premature replacements, increasing costs and reducing asset lifespan.

Budgeting and Forecasting Are Compromised: Asset data informs financial planning, including capital expenditure and operational budgets. Flawed records result in unreliable forecasts and inefficient resource allocation.

Inefficient Resource Utilization: Without accurate asset information, organizations may over-allocate or under-allocate resources, reducing operational efficiency.

The Need for Automated Asset Tracking Solutions

To mitigate the risks associated with manual data entry, companies are increasingly adopting automated asset tracking solutions. These systems use technologies such as Radio Frequency Identification (RFID), Internet of Things (IoT), and barcode scanning to accurately capture and record asset information in real time.

Benefits of Automated Asset Tracking

Enhanced Data Accuracy: Automated systems significantly reduce human error by capturing data directly from the asset itself.

Real-Time Asset Visibility: With real-time tracking, companies gain instant access to accurate asset information, improving decision-making.

Accurate Valuation and Depreciation: By automating data collection, companies ensure that asset acquisition dates, purchase costs, and depreciation schedules are accurately recorded.

Improved Planning and Forecasting: Reliable asset data enables better financial planning, maintenance scheduling, and resource allocation.
